Warden The following business was transacted: El I hereby certify that pursuant to a notice dated November 3, 2020, and duly published November 6, 2020, in the Greeley Tribune, a public hearing was conducted to consider the 2021 Final Budget for Weld County. Donald Warden, Director of Finance and Administration, made this a matter of record and reviewed the summary of 2021 Budget Changes made since the Proposed Budget. Mr. Warden further summarized budgetary amounts as reflected in Exhibit A to the Adoption Resolution. IR Chair Freeman opened the matter for public comment; however, there was no public testimony. ki Commissioner Kirkmeyer moved to approve the Resolution to Summarize Expenditures and Revenues for Each Fund and to Adopt the 2021 Budget as submitted. The motion was seconded by Commissioner Ross, and it carried unanimously. • Mr. Warden confirmed Emergency Ordinance #257, In the Matter of the Annual Appropriation for Weld County, Colorado, for Fiscal Year 2021, was previously read into the record by audio, and he reviewed the amounts reflected in Exhibit A. He explained the emergency status is due to the assessed valuation received by the Assessor five (5) days prior to the hearing date. • No public testimony was offered concerning this matter. Commissioner Kirkmeyer moved to approve Ordinance #257 on an emergency basis. The motion was seconded by Commissioner Moreno, and it carried unanimously. • Mr. Warden recommended approval of the Resolution setting the mill levy at 15.038 mills, which is anticipated to generate $225,047,613.00. The total mill levy is actually 22.038 and he is recommending a continuation of a temporary mill levy reduction of 7.000 mills, for a net reduction of 8.361 mills and a temporary reduction for the general fund.
